Transaction 56730e636b765227470c46a28c790cbb1c598dfbd712b9486232bf9180608055
1 Input
1 Output
-
56730e636b765227470c46a28c790cbb1c598dfbd712b9486232bf9180608055:0
- value
- 5020220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ae4e9401ef3bf4bdaa29bc526564eaa0eb123a25 OP_EQUAL
- address
- 3HafddPJtKLLWWVDHkPsbM8MaX9Fjm3FQk